The Victoria line has had an oddly poor 72 or so hours this week due to 'signalling system faults' repeated with the entire line suspended at one point last night.

What is going on?

Based on remarks elsewhere it seems there have been track problems including a broken rail. The signalling system crashed and then a software upgrade also failed (that was this morning). I’ve not heard anything about any upgrades failing. The signal system failed just before close of traffic on Thursday night however trains were still moving on the ground, because this problem could not be sorted the staff moved to the backup control room before start of traffic Friday. During engineering hours a broken rail was discovered and there were Green Park during the AM peak.

Just after 1am on Friday night so the Night Tube Service was suspended to allow systems to be rebooted and to staff to go back to the normal control room. The system then failed again yesterday morning.
